#65fb1c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65fb1c is composed of 39.6% red, 98.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.8%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 100.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 54.7%. #65fb1c color hex could be obtained by blending #caff38 with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#65fb1c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010400 is the darkest color, while #f5fff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#65fb1c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a9087 is the less saturated color, while #65fb1c is the most saturated one.
